Oklahoma coach Bob Stoops 'excited' to have ex-Michigan recruit Kellen Jones on roster
One-time Michigan football recruit Kellen Jones now is on the roster at Oklahoma, The Oklahoman reported.
"We are excited to add Kellen to our program," Oklahoma coach Bob Stoops said. "Obviously he's in a learning phase right now, but he has very good physical skill and is someone who can contribute to our program."
Jones, a 6-foot-1, 210-pound linebacker from Houston, gave a verbal commitment to the Michigan football program in January, but was never listed on the Michigan roster. "He's just not enrolled at the school," Michigan coach Brady Hoke said in July.
